About Ricebowl AI
Ricebowl AI is a video generator aimed specifically at ecommerce, giving access to a spread of current video models on one subscription rather than requiring an account with each provider. Plans are metered in credits, and the vendor publishes an estimated video count per plan as a range rather than a number.
That range is the most useful thing on their pricing page, and it is unusually honest. A plan at 12,000 credits is described as roughly 38 to 600 videos, which is a sixteen-fold spread, and the reason is that a short clip on a cheap model and a longer clip on a frontier model cost wildly different amounts. Most vendors in this category quote the flattering end and let you discover the rest. Stating the range means you can see that the number of videos you get depends far more on which model you pick than on which plan you buy.
The aggregator position carries the usual trade. You are buying convenience and one bill rather than a model somebody built, and if a provider reprices, that reaches you eventually.
You choose a model for the job. That decision, more than the plan, determines what your credits buy, which is why the estimated video ranges are so wide.
You generate from a product image or a prompt, aimed at the formats ecommerce actually uses: product clips, variations for paid social, short-form for marketplaces.
Credits are drawn down per generation, and the plan tiers differ in credit volume rather than in features. Annual billing is offered at a stated saving against the monthly rate.

Ecommerce operators producing video for listings and paid social who would rather hold one subscription than four. The value is concentrated where you use several models and would otherwise pay several vendors.
Anyone experimenting across models to find which suits their product, since switching is a dropdown rather than a new account.
It is the wrong choice if you have settled on one model and use it heavily, where going direct is usually cheaper. There is also no free tier, so evaluation costs a month, and the credit ranges mean you should generate on your intended model before judging what a plan actually buys.
